Description

An allocation of resources without limits vulnerability in the HTTP handler component of Google mcp-toolbox versions up to and including 1.4.0 allows an unauthenticated attacker to cause a denial of service (DoS). The /mcp endpoint handler reads incoming payloads directly into system memory using an unrestricted buffer loop (io.ReadAll) without applying defensive constraints such as http.MaxBytesReader or pre-read Content-Length enforcement. By submitting a single, massive HTTP request body, an attacker can linearly consume available host memory until the runtime process is terminated by an Out-Of-Memory (OOM) error.
